Innovations in Game Development and Breakthroughs of AI in Art and Design
The emergence of Artificial intelligence (AI) has led to a major breakthrough in the game industry in the field of art design, which has attracted widespread attention from game developers and enthusiasts. The application of this technology not only provides developers with more room for creativity, but also brings a series of challenges.
Automatic Generation of Game Content
Traditionally, game art design is a time-consuming and labor-intensive process that requires art designers to do a lot of tedious work, such as creating character models, designing scenes, and creating details, but in recent years, the emergence of AI technology has changed this pattern. AI can automatically generate a large amount of game content, from maps and terrains, to character styling and props design within the game, which is not only a time-saving and development cost-saving, but also an opportunity for developers to create their own games. This not only saves time and development costs, but also provides developers with more room for creativity.
Enhanced Graphic Quality
Any classic, popular and memorable gaming experience on the market usually requires excellent graphic quality. Leveraging AI technologies, graphics quality can be improved with high-resolution textures, realistic lighting, and smoother animation effects. These techniques not only improve the realism of game scenes and sophisticated on-screen effects, but also enhance the visual appeal of the game, making it more competitive and appealing to a wider range of players.
Personalized Game Experience
AI can also be used to provide a personalized game experience. By analyzing players' behaviors and preferences, the game can automatically adjust the difficulty level, storyline, and game content to meet the needs of different players. This personalized experience can increase player engagement, improve satisfaction, and encourage them to continue playing.
Challenges and Drawbacks
Although the use of AI in game art design brings many advantages, it also faces some challenges and drawbacks.
Creative Constraints
Over-reliance on AI can lead to a monotonous game design. Developers may lose sight of the creative side because they rely too much on generated content. This may result in all games looking similar and lacking uniqueness.
Quality Control
AI-generated graphics and content may not always meet the developer's expectations. Quality control will become more difficult, as AI-generated graphics often require more supervision and adjustment than before, especially on issues such as graphical consistency and issues related to human and ethno-cultural aspects, and producers will need to put more effort into monitoring to ensure the quality of the game is standardized.
Intellectual Property Rights
AI mapping techniques often use a large number of datasets and models to generate images and resources. However, these datasets often contain material created by different artists and designers. Therefore, a key question is how to protect the rights of the creators of these images when they are generated by AI.
In addition, whether AI-generated images are independently copyrighted is another controversial issue. AI-generated content is not strictly created by humans, so should it be in the public domain?
As the use of AI in the gaming industry continues to evolve, it has also led to a variety of legal controversies. In order for this new technology to be successfully applied to future business models, and to ensure that the rights of creators are protected, it is necessary to actively engage the industry, legal experts and the government in the discussion.
